About Us
Noralta Technologies is an energy service company that combines patented technology and expert service to support oil and gas producers across Western Canada and the USA. Our mission is to understand the goals and challenges our clients face, continually innovate, and develop solutions that help them succeed. We aim to be exceptional partners, evolving technologies and services, and celebrating successes alongside our clients.
Why Work With Us
At Noralta, our technology teams form a tight-knit community where Client Support Analysts thrive in a dynamic and fast-paced environment. If you're the kind of person who enjoys solving complex problems and adapting solutions creatively, you’ll fit right in. You'll start with structured onboarding and hands-on training in oil & gas and SCADA, so you can grow into the role rather than needing every skill on day one. From there, you’ll be exposed to a wide array of technologies, learning something new every day and continuously expanding your skill set. We emphasize work/life balance, provide the tools needed for success, and reward commitment with opportunities for growth. Our current setup supports a hybrid work environment.
What You'll Do
We are looking for a tech-savvy, detail-oriented problem solver to join our Support team as a Client Support Analyst. Although this is not a field, coding, or PLC programming role, some coding experience is preferred. You’ll work directly with our field staff, control room operators, IT personnel, and customers, providing tailored support and solutions for their SCADA and site security integration needs.
Primary Duties and Responsibilities
- Establish, test, and troubleshoot remote connections to specialized field devices across cellular, radio, and satellite networks, using a variety of telemetry protocols
- Create and configure SCADA datapoints, such as pressures, temperatures, and flowrates from a broad variety of PLCs or RTUs, while ensuring consistency and accuracy
- Implement graphical user interfaces (HMIs) to convert data into information, providing operational awareness and control to our clients and our control room operators
- Commission and test completed projects alongside internal or external field services staff.
- Conduct preventative and reactive maintenance to servers and services
- Investigate and troubleshoot internal and customer related issues
- Provide support to our valued clients, 24/7 control room, and field services staff
- Track all work in a service management ticketing system
Requirements
- Strong attention to detail
- Ability to work an 8-hour shift within the hours of 7:00 am to 6:00 pm MST and participate in a 24/7 on-call rotation
- Experience working in an operational or business (non-enterprise) application support role at a Tier 2 level, supporting complex business and/or in-house developed applications and technologies
- A customer-oriented mindset and strong aptitude for delivering high-quality service
- Strong communication skills (written and oral) for interacting with internal and external stakeholders
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, capable of diagnosing and resolving technical issues efficiently
Nice-to-Haves
- Post-secondary diploma or degree in IT, instrumentation, process control, or a related field
- Proven experience with SCADA Host, PLCs, DCS, or HMI systems (especially ABB SCADAvantage)
- Familiarity with SQL, Windows Server, and/or C#.NET
- Work term or co-op experience in the oil and gas industry
- Knowledge of upstream oilfield automation, compliance, and operations
- Experience with cellular, radio, and serial communications
- Experience utilizing service management ticketing systems
